About Rebecca Holley

Rebecca Holley is a scholar working on Cell Biology, Physiology and Genetics, having authored 33 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Lysosomal Storage Disorders Research (20 papers), Proteoglycans and glycosaminoglycans research (9 papers) and Cellular transport and secretion (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cell Biology (399 citations), Physiology (479 citations) and Ophthalmology (102 citations). Rebecca Holley has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Netherlands and United States. Frequent co-authors include Catherine L.R. Merry, Brian Bigger, Claire E. Pickford, Fiona L. Wilkinson, Kia Langford‐Smith, Aiyin Liao, Alex Langford-Smith, Claire O’Leary, Robert Wynn and Simon Jones.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Blood and PLoS ONE.
